
Carat's campaigns include work for Diageo's Baileys and Vauxhall, which are up for two awards each. Mediacom has for campaigns with double nominations: Sky Movies, Sony Experia, Universal PIctures and GSK's Night Nurse.
This year sees two new awards categories, Best use of Social Media and Best use of Content, which recognise the best of planning and execution of advertising for magazine brands. Brands up for these awards include, Clinique, Dunlop, Kerry Foods and Audible, as well as Cisco by OMD which is nominated in both categories.
Mindshare’s campaign for Ford Fiesta and Stylist’s 24 hour issue has been nominated in every category, and Kopparberg UK: Eklektic Magazine by GoodStuff sees three nominations.
"This year we’ve been delighted by the diversity, ingenuity and execution of the campaigns entered into the PPA Advertising Awards," said James Papworth, marketing director of the PPA. "There is so much going on in this space right now, that it’s wonderful to be able to put this work and those that produced it, in the limelight."
The winners will be announced at a ceremony at Paramount in London on 8 October.
